And even though you might think all of those "not polite" moments meant the cast members (opens in new tab) got to run rampant on the MTV reality series, it turns out there was a whole list of rules the seven strangers had to follow each season.
From 1992 to 2017, the series put together a group of young adults in a city to live together and be filmed non-stop (per IMDb).
